What Causes Learning Difficulties?
Learning is a
natural process - our very survival depends on it. Through play, a child learns
to eat, to move, to speak and respond,
stimulated by pleasurable experiences and learning
from painful ones
With the aid of
parents and teachers the horizons are opened even further.
All the time our
nervous system is practising integrating what our senses of sight, smell,
taste, touch, feel and balance tell us, with the changes that occur when our
brain and body respond.
Imagine if there
were some confusion in the nervous system as a result of birth trauma,
concussion, food sensitivities, infection, emotional stress or delayed
development - in
a particular area of the brain. The natural learning process would be slowed
down.
“Confusion in the nervous
system and lack of access to brain functions is the basis of virtually all
learning difficulties”.
Why is my child so capable in many areas
but can’t spell?
Confusion in the
nervous system and lack of access to brain functions,
can be in very specific areas. This is why we commonly see quite intelligent
children who cannot spell.
Frequently this
is an inability to make, or remember, mental “pictures” of words. All spelling
is done (often inappropriately) by phonetics i.e. the way a word sounds.

What to Expect at IHK Consultations
Initial
Consultation -
discussion of areas of concern
detailed assessment to determine the learning
strengths and weaknesses
determination of a treatment plan with an estimate of
how many sessions it is likely to take (typically 10x1hr)
referral for additional treatment if considered
necessary
Subsequent
sessions -
correction of deep levels of confusion in the
nervous system
establishing a stable foundation of brain integration
- even under stress
increase the access to brain areas or functions
identified as problems in the initial consultation
overcoming self esteem issues and forming positive
attitudes to learning
Reassessment -
checking that all the learning functions have
been corrected
giving follow up exercises
arranging tutoring or a home reinforcement self
help programme with parents
Follow up -
2-3 months after
the final consultation, to check on progress and correct any further problems
that may have arisen
